hugetlb_change_protectionRegular
4.4: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ff811ddfc0)
Location: mm/hugetlb.c:3931
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ff811ddfc0-ffffffff811de2c3: hugetlb_change_protection (STB_GLOBAL)
4.8: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ff811fc3a0)
Location: mm/hugetlb.c:3954
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ff811fc3a0-ffffffff811fc6a0: hugetlb_change_protection (STB_GLOBAL)
4.10: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ff8120ce90)
Location: mm/hugetlb.c:4068
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ff8120ce90-ffffffff8120d18c: hugetlb_change_protection (STB_GLOBAL)
4.13: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ff81218cf0)
Location: mm/hugetlb.c:4224
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ff81218cf0-ffffffff81218fea: hugetlb_change_protection (STB_GLOBAL)
4.15: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ff81233ca0)
Location: mm/hugetlb.c:4273
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ff81233ca0-ffffffff81233f8b: hugetlb_change_protection (STB_GLOBAL)
4.18: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ff81256c60)
Location: mm/hugetlb.c:4302
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ff81256c60-ffffffff81256f61: hugetlb_change_protection (STB_GLOBAL)
5.0: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ff8126b1d0)
Location: mm/hugetlb.c:4343
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ff8126b1d0-ffffffff8126b5dc: hugetlb_change_protection (STB_GLOBAL)
5.3: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ff812864a0)
Location: mm/hugetlb.c:4436
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ff812864a0-ffffffff812868d0: hugetlb_change_protection (STB_GLOBAL)
5.4: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ff81296080)
Location: mm/hugetlb.c:4553
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ff81296080-ffffffff812964c9: hugetlb_change_protection (STB_GLOBAL)
5.8: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ff812c95c0)
Location: mm/hugetlb.c:5011
Inline: False
Symbols:
ffffffff812c95c0-ffffffff812c9a6c: hugetlb_change_protection (STB_GLOBAL)
5.11: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ff812d51e0)
Location: mm/hugetlb.c:5001
Inline: False
Symbols:
ffffffff812d51e0-ffffffff812d56af: hugetlb_change_protection (STB_GLOBAL)
5.13: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ff812dbfe0)
Location: mm/hugetlb.c:5276
Inline: False
Symbols:
ffffffff812dbfe0-ffffffff812dc438: hugetlb_change_protection (STB_GLOBAL)
5.15: Transformation ⚠️long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/hugetlb.c (0)
Location: mm/hugetlb.c:5611
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ff81cbfe86-ffffffff81cbff1b: hugetlb_change_protection.cold (STB_LOCAL)
ffffffff81323150-ffffffff813235e7: hugetlb_change_protection (STB_GLOBAL)
5.19: Transformation ⚠️long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ot, long unsigned int cp_flags);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/hugetlb.c (0)
Location: mm/hugetlb.c:6301
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ff81e7220b-ffffffff81e7225e: hugetlb_change_protection.cold (STB_LOCAL)
ffffffff813909c0-ffffffff81391143: hugetlb_change_protection (STB_GLOBAL)
6.2: Transformation ⚠️long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ot, long unsigned int cp_flags);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/hugetlb.c (0)
Location: mm/hugetlb.c:6630
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ff82066f61-ffffffff82066fde: hugetlb_change_protection.cold (STB_LOCAL)
ffffffff81412120-ffffffff8141297e: hugetlb_change_protection (STB_GLOBAL)
6.5: Transformation ⚠️long int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ot, long unsigned int cp_flags);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/hugetlb.c (0)
Location: mm/hugetlb.c:6723
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ff820e681d-ffffffff820e689a: hugetlb_change_protection.cold (STB_LOCAL)
ffffffff814456e0-ffffffff81445fc3: hugetlb_change_protection (STB_GLOBAL)
6.8: Transformation ⚠️long int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ot, long unsigned int cp_flags);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/hugetlb.c (0)
Location: mm/hugetlb.c:6856
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ff821c393a-ffffffff821c39cf: hugetlb_change_protection.cold (STB_LOCAL)
ffffffff8147f100-ffffffff8147fa2c: hugetlb_change_protection (STB_GLOBAL)
arm64: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ffff8000103357b8)
Location: mm/hugetlb.c:4553
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ffff8000103357b8-ffff800010335ce8: hugetlb_change_protection (STB_GLOBAL)
armhf: Full Inline ⚠️Collision: Unique Static
Inline: Full
Transformation: False
Instances:
In mm/mprotect.c (0)
Location: include/linux/hugetlb.h:197
Inline: True
ppc64el: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(c00000000040fa90)
Location: mm/hugetlb.c:4553
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
c00000000040fa90-c00000000040ff58: hugetlb_change_protection (STB_GLOBAL)
riscv64: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ffe000230c0a)
Location: mm/hugetlb.c:4553
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ffe000230c0a-ffffffe000230eee: hugetlb_change_protection (STB_GLOBAL)
aws: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ff8128e660)
Location: mm/hugetlb.c:4553
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ff8128e660-ffffffff8128eaa9: hugetlb_change_protection (STB_GLOBAL)
azure: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ff81280420)
Location: mm/hugetlb.c:4553
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ff81280420-ffffffff8128084e: hugetlb_change_protection (STB_GLOBAL)
gcp: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ff8128c470)
Location: mm/hugetlb.c:4553
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ff8128c470-ffffffff8128c8b9: hugetlb_change_protection (STB_GLOBAL)
lowlatency: ✅long unsigned int hugetlb_change_protection(struct vm_area_struct *vma, long unsigned int address, long unsigned int end, pgprot_t newprot);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/hugetlb.c (ffffffff8129c260)
Location: mm/hugetlb.c:4553
Inline: False
Direct callers:
- mm/mprotect.c:change_protection
Symbols:
ffffffff8129c260-ffffffff8129c68d: hugetlb_change_protection (STB_GLOBAL)
Regular
4.4 and 4.8 ✅
4.8 and 4.10 ✅
4.10 and 4.13 ✅
4.13 and 4.15 ✅
4.15 and 4.18 ✅
4.18 and 5.0 ✅
5.0 and 5.3 ✅
5.3 and 5.4 ✅
5.4 and 5.8 ✅
5.8 and 5.11 ✅
5.11 and 5.13 ✅
5.13 and 5.15 ✅
5.15 and 5.19 ⚠️long unsigned int cp_flags
5.19 and 6.2 ✅
6.2 and 6.5 ⚠️long unsigned int ➡️ long int
6.5 and 6.8 ✅
amd64 and arm64 ✅
amd64 and ppc64el ✅
amd64 and riscv64 ✅
generic and aws ✅
generic and azure ✅
generic and gcp ✅
generic and lowlatency ✅